THE ROLE
Hallett Maintenance Services are a growing team that are making a real difference to the reliability and performance of our fixed plant. You will play a critical role in supporting the maintenance team by planning and scheduling preventative and corrective maintenance activities across Hallett Group to ensure minimal disruption to production, optimised equipment performance and reduce unplanned downtime.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ILTIES
• Managing detailed maintenance schedules and work orders
• Coordinating and scheduling all PM maintenance activities
• Ensuring that all maintenance work complies with safety regulations and industry standards
• Maintaining accurate records of maintenance performed, equipment condition, and maintenance costs
• Procuring necessary maintenance supplies and equipment
• Processing of equipment oil samples for analysis
• Working with vendors and contractors as needed
• Participating in the development and implementation of maintenance policies, procedures, and best practices
